A Fortune 500 company recently completed a multi-year renovation project of their headquarters in Minnesota.  ESI Engineering was the acoustics consultant to the design team for all six phases of the project.  Spaces that we worked on included the executive suite (CEO suite, boardroom, private offices, and meeting rooms), executive conference center, typical conference center, typical office areas, video studio, and rooftop / penthouse mechanical areas.  Our services included:

  • Testing of existing room acoustics, office and meeting room privacy, open office privacy (see photo below), and HVAC noise.
  • Troubleshooting HVAC, emergency generator, and electrical transformer noise and vibration and developing noise / vibration control recommendations (see photos below).
  • Room acoustic evaluations and development of treatment recommendations (see photos below) to meet established reverberation time (RT60) criteria.
  • Speech privacy evaluations and development of sound isolation (see photo below), absorption, and masking recommendations to meet established speech privacy class (SPC) criteria.
  • Sound masking system commissioning.
  • Post-construction conformance testing of room acoustic, speech privacy, and HVAC / masking sound conditions to verify compliance with project criteria.
